The novelty of artificial intelligence (AI) in medicine cannot be overstated. In recent years, there has been a surge in the development of AI-powered healthcare technologies that are transforming the way healthcare is delivered. These technologies have the potential to significantly improve patient outcomes and reduce healthcare costs. One example of the novelty of AI in medicine is the use of machine learning algorithms to analyze medical images. This has led to the development of more accurate and efficient diagnostic tools. Another example is the use of AI-powered chatbots to provide patients with personalized medical advice and support. These chatbots can answer common medical questions, provide medication reminders, and even schedule appointments. The potential for AI in medicine is truly endless, and we are only scratching the surface of what is possible.
However, the novelty of AI in medicine also brings with it a number of challenges. One of the biggest challenges is ensuring that these technologies are safe and reliable. As with any new technology, there is always the risk of unintended consequences. For example, if an AI-powered diagnostic tool produces a false positive, it could lead to unnecessary medical procedures and harm to the patient. Another challenge is ensuring that these technologies are accessible to everyone, regardless of their socioeconomic status. AI-powered healthcare technologies have the potential to exacerbate existing health disparities if they are not designed with equity in mind.
